Ogra Cuts LPG Prices by Rs6.7 Per Kg for October 2025

ISLAMABAD: The Oil and Gas Regulatory Authority (OGRA) has reduced the price of LPG by Rs 6.70 per Kilogram for October 2025.

According to a notification issued by the regulator, the notified consumer price now stands at Rs2,448.33 per cylinder, registering a decline from Rs2,527.47 in September. On a per-ton basis, the Ogra has also reduced LPG consumer prices to Rs 207,485.64 from Rs 214,192.42.

According to OGRA, the decline follows a 3.78% drop in the Saudi Aramco Contract Price (CP). The dollar exchange rate also edged up by 0.23%. The adjustment translates into a per-kilogram decrease of Rs 6.70 for consumers.
